Rear drop?

So I already put 2" lowering shackles on my 85 c10 but I want to go just 2 more inches. What are some ways for me to do this?

Re: Rear drop?

Drop hangers for the front of the leaf springs. They are usually 2" drop also so that would make a total of 4" when used with the rear shackles.
